Understanding the Mechanics of Pacific Spin
At its core, the pacific spin technique relies on the principle of imparting an irregular, almost panicked motion to a lure. Unlike a steady retrieve, which can appear predictable to fish, this method introduces subtle variations in speed and direction, creating a more lifelike presentation. This is often achieved through a combination of rod tip movement, reel speed adjustments, and the inherent design of the lure itself. The specific characteristics of the lure – its weight, shape, and balance – play a crucial role in determining how effectively it can be worked with this technique. Lures designed for this purpose often feature a unique profile and weighting system to maximize their spinning and wobbling action. The range of lures suitable for pacific spin is extensive, from shallow-diving crankbaits to soft plastic swimbaits and even spoons.
The Role of Lure Selection
Choosing the right lure is paramount to success when employing the pacific spin method. Factors to consider include water clarity, depth, the target species, and the prevailing conditions. In clear water, more natural-looking lures with subtle colors and patterns tend to be more effective, while brighter, more flashy lures can excel in murky or low-light conditions. The weight of the lure also influences its action and casting distance. Heavier lures are better suited for deeper water and stronger currents, while lighter lures are more versatile and can be worked at slower speeds. Understanding the relationship between lure weight and action is a key skill for any angler looking to master this technique. Experimentation is often necessary to determine which lures perform best in a given situation.
The action of the lure, how it moves through the water, is influenced by its design. Lures with a wider wobble are good for attracting attention, while lures with a tighter wobble offer a more subtle presentation. It’s important to match the lure action to the natural movements of the prey fish in the target area. Remembering that the goal is to create an illusion.

Adapting Pacific Spin to Different Environments
The versatility of the pacific spin technique allows it to be effectively employed in a wide range of fishing environments. From coastal saltwater flats to freshwater lakes and rivers, the basic principles remain the same, but the specific application must be tailored to the unique characteristics of each location. In saltwater environments, anglers often target species like snook, redfish, and sea trout by working soft plastic swimbaits or shallow-diving crankbaits along mangrove edges and grass flats. The current and tidal flow play crucial roles in these environments, and anglers must adjust their retrieve speed and lure presentation accordingly. In freshwater settings, the technique can be used to target bass, walleye, pike, and other predatory fish in lakes, rivers, and streams. Varying the retrieve speed and incorporating pauses can be particularly effective in triggering strikes from inactive fish.
Considering Current and Structure
One of the key factors to consider when using pacific spin is the influence of current and structure. In areas with strong currents, anglers may need to use heavier lures to maintain contact with the bottom and prevent the lure from being swept away. Working the lure along structural features like rocks, weeds, and submerged timber can also increase the likelihood of a strike. These structures provide cover for fish and create ambush points where they can lie in wait for prey. Understanding how the current interacts with these structures is crucial for identifying productive fishing spots. The current can create eddies and seams that concentrate baitfish, attracting predatory fish in the process. Paying attention to these subtle changes in the water flow can give anglers a significant advantage.

Mastering the Retrieve: Rod Action and Reel Speed
While lure selection is important, the way the lure is retrieved is equally crucial when employing the pacific spin technique. The goal is to impart an erratic, lifelike action to the lure that mimics the movements of a wounded or escaping prey fish. This is achieved through a combination of rod tip movement and reel speed adjustments. A common technique involves using short, sharp rod twitches to create a snapping action, followed by a brief pause to allow the lure to flutter and fall. Varying the length and intensity of the twitches can create different presentations, appealing to different fish and in diverse situations. The reel speed should be synchronized with the rod action to maintain consistent line tension and prevent slack. Adjusting the reel speed based on the lure’s action and the current conditions is essential.
Developing a Subtle Touch
Mastering the retrieve requires developing a subtle touch and a keen sense of feel. Anglers must learn to detect subtle changes in line tension and lure movement, which can indicate a strike or the presence of fish. Pay attention to the weight of the lure and the resistance it encounters as it moves through the water. Any sudden change in resistance could signal a fish has taken the bait. Experimenting with different rod actions and reel speeds is the best way to develop this sensitivity. Practice in a controlled environment, such as a swimming pool or a calm pond, can help anglers refine their technique without the added complexity of currents and structure. Listening to the sound of the line as it cuts through the water can also be informative.

Beyond the Basics: Advanced Techniques for Pacific Spin
Once the fundamental principles of the pacific spin technique are mastered, anglers can explore more advanced techniques to further enhance their effectiveness. One such technique involves incorporating pauses and stops into the retrieve, allowing the lure to sink and create a seductive wobble. This can be particularly effective for targeting fish that are holding near the bottom or in deep cover. Another advanced technique involves using a stop-and-go retrieve, alternating between periods of rapid reeling and sudden pauses. This erratic action can mimic the frantic movements of a baitfish trying to escape a predator. Experiment with different pause lengths and retrieve speeds to find what works best in a given situation. Paying attention to the fish’s reaction is crucial for fine-tuning your presentation.
